Bio

Born in Monterey, California, Thomas Pare comes from a proud military family where both of his parents served on active duty. Frequent moves were part of his early life until his family eventually settled in Belton, Texas, where he attended middle and high school. He went on to earn his Bachelor’s Degree in Business Administration from Texas State University in 2013, laying the groundwork for his analytical and client-focused approach to legal practice.

Thomas earned his Juris Doctor Degree from St. Mary’s University School of Law in San Antonio, Texas in 2016, but his passion for trial work began well before graduation. As a law student, he actively participated in multiple Student Trial Advocacy Competitions hosted by the American Association for Justice, sharpening the courtroom skills that would become the foundation of his practice.

Following law school, Thomas immediately immersed himself in criminal defense, handling a wide range of cases and building a reputation for meticulous preparation and fearless advocacy. His early experiences in the courtroom solidified his belief that every individual deserves a tenacious and ethical defense, no matter the circumstances.

In 2019, he brought his skills and dedication to The Law Offices of David C. Hardaway, where he continues to fight for the rights of individuals facing criminal charges.
